Wiktionary
RELOCATION, noun. The act of moving from one place to another.
RELOCATION, noun. Renewal of a lease.
Dictionary definition
RELOCATION, noun. The transportation of people (as a family or colony) to a new settlement (as after an upheaval of some kind).
RELOCATION, noun. The act of changing your residence or place of business; "they say that three moves equal one fire".
